New Canaan High School Service League of Boys (SLOBs) is a philanthropic club for sons and parents to initiate and promote educational and charitable endeavors that foster community responsibility and leadership, as well as strengthen the parent-son relationship.
Joining Is Easy!
SLOBs membership registration is open from June 1st to mid-November each year.
Both new and returning members must register each year.
